Output f21a4665feb2c456ea62ae62462668787f38752304034bda3d72de2124c41729:27

value
262144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5c21ce20d9a55d11313b9ee7a920cf3815937b8e18a568769bd8f8086d84739e
address
tb1ptssuugxe54w3zvfmnmn6jgx08q2ex7uwrzjksa5mmruqsmvyww0qs8xxwc
transaction
f21a4665feb2c456ea62ae62462668787f38752304034bda3d72de2124c41729
confirmations
18944
spent
true